Background: | IL6 is a multifaceted cytokine pivotal in orchestrating host defense mechanisms through the modulation of immune and inflammatory responses. Generated by an array of cell types including T cells, monocytes, fibroblasts, endothelial cells, and keratinocytes, IL6 exhibits diverse biological roles. It fosters B-cell differentiation and enhances antibody production, collaborates with IL3 in megakaryocyte maturation and platelet formation, triggers the synthesis of acute-phase proteins in the liver, and governs bone metabolism. Signaling of IL6 is mediated via the IL6 receptor system, comprising two components: IL6R alpha and gp130. Notably, mouse-derived IL6 remains inert on human cells, whereas both human and mouse versions display equal potency on mouse cells. |
